Aerodrome de Saint-Valery - Vittefleur (LFOS)

Description

L’aérodrome de Saint-Valery - Vittefleur (code OACI : LFOS) est un aérodrome civil, ouvert à la circulation aérienne publique (CAP)1, situé sur les communes de Saint-Sylvain, de Saint-Riquier-ès-Plains et de Vittefleur à 6 km au sud-ouest de Saint-Valery-en-Caux dans la Seine-Maritime (région Haute-Normandie, France). Il est utilisé pour la pratique d’activités de loisirs et de tourisme (aviation légère). The above description has been prepared by IPACS forum user jpx. Download instructions for a fully modelled airport follow Click for basic TSC

  1. Create folder My PC > Documents > Aerofly FS2 > scenery > places > FR
  2. Download LFOS.zip file to your FR folder and unzip to folder LFOS/
  3. Download xref_lib_water_towers.zip to My PC > Documents > Aerofly FS2 > scenery > xref and unzip to folder xref_lib_water_towers/ (only do this once and it applies for all FSCP airports
  4. Go Fly!
